Ellerslie Palms Motel - Auckland
-36.8962516784668, 174.83464050293The 3-star Ellerslie Palms Motel Auckland is 4.2 km from Point England Reserve and offers tour/ticket assistance, as well as cars for rent. This Auckland motel provides guests with Wi-Fi throughout the property.
Location
The pet-friendly property is about 20 km from Auckland airport and 15 minutes' drive from such cultural venues as Mangere Bridge. The nearby places of worship include Mountainside Lutheran Church (850 metres) and Holy Trinity Cathedral (7 km). There is Stardome the Auckland Observatory 4.8 km from this hotel.
Ellerslie Palms Motel is near a tube station and Harris Road bus stop is about a 5-minute stroll away.
Rooms
You can stay in one of the 24 sound-proofed rooms featuring a TV set along with an electric kettle. Guests can also make use of a separate toilet and a shower, as well as comforts such as a shower cap and bath sheets.
Leisure & Business
Barbecue grills and a golf course are available for an additional charge.
